Capturing the Essence: Bracelet Designs for Every Collector
When choosing a bracelet, consider designs that echo the aesthetics and symbolism of your favorite specimens.
- Nature-Inspired Motifs: Look for bracelets featuring delicate wing patterns, antennae details, or even subtle insect silhouettes. These can be crafted from various metals, from sterling silver to bronze, offering a refined touch.
- Gemstones Reflecting Nature's Palette: The vibrant hues of butterfly wings and the earthy tones of insect exoskeletons can be beautifully represented by gemstones. Think of deep blues and purples for certain butterfly species, or earthy browns and greens for beetles.
- Personalized Touches: Some collectors appreciate bracelets that can be personalized with initials, dates, or even small charms representing specific species.

Choosing Your Perfect Piece
When selecting a bracelet, consider:
- Material: Do you prefer the natural feel of stone, the gleam of metal, or a combination?
- Style: Are you drawn to minimalist designs, statement pieces, or something in between?
- Symbolism: Does the design or the stones used hold a particular meaning for you?
- Comfort: Will it be comfortable for everyday wear, especially if you spend time outdoors?
